CC   -!- FUNCTION: Forms part of the ribosomal stalk, playing a central role in
CC       the interaction of the ribosome with GTP-bound translation factors.
CC       {ECO:0000255|HAMAP-Rule:MF_00280}.
CC   -!- SUBUNIT: Part of the 50S ribosomal subunit. Forms part of the ribosomal
CC       stalk which helps the ribosome interact with GTP-bound translation
CC       factors. Forms a heptameric L10(L12)2(L12)2(L12)2 complex, where L10
CC       forms an elongated spine to which the L12 dimers bind in a sequential
CC       fashion. {ECO:0000255|HAMAP-Rule:MF_00280}.
CC   -!- SIMILARITY: Belongs to the universal ribosomal protein uL10 family.
CC       {ECO:0000255|HAMAP-Rule:MF_00280}.
